Organizations responsible for critical infrastructure often deploy private mobile networks to satisfy requirements for coverage, performance, and security. Infrastructure such as energy grids, transportation hubs, industrial sites, and correctional facilities often cover large areas in remote locations where commercial mobile coverage is inconsistent or insufficient. These sites may also need visibility and control over how communications are used, especially in restricted areas. Private networks help address these challenges by increasing operator control over radio coverage, device authentication, traffic prioritization, and integration with operational technology systems.
Especially when they are operated by government entities, private networks must often meet the same regulatory obligations for supporting lawful interception as public networks. Location and lawful intelligence can also play a crucial role in both physical and cyber security by controlling and monitoring access to the communications network while isolating traffic from public networks. At a time of rising threats, these measures directly support the missions of critical infrastructure and facilities, protecting against everything from internal threats to hostile nation-states.
Private network operators typically lack the long‑established compliance frameworks that exist at public mobile network operators (MNOs). Unfamiliar challenges include ensuring that lawful interception interfaces are implemented correctly, that location information is available and accurate, and that investigative workflows are compatible with operational integrity. Lawful Interception Across Private Network Deployment Models
A private network’s connectivity (or lack of connectivity) to public MNO networks is a central consideration for lawful intelligence. From that perspective, it can be described in one of three architecture categories: as an island air gapped from the outside world, as a logically isolated segment of a public network, or as a hybrid of the two. Each of those models provides discrete advantages for different types of deployments as well as different considerations for lawful interception, signaling visibility, and data correlation.
In a self-contained “island” architecture, all network functions and equipment reside within the private network, under the control of the operating organization. This model is common in remote infrastructure such as oil rigs or in high-security ones such as energy or defense installations and correctional facilities. Because the private operator controls the full stack, it has sole responsibility for interception mechanisms, data retention, and location services.
MNOs can define private networks using network slicing to create logical segments of the public network, using MNO fabric while retaining isolation from outside traffic. Using existing infrastructure is particularly valuable for implementations over very large areas, such as transportation corridors and distributed utility grids. While deployments can rely on the MNO for lawful interception compliance, organizations still require visibility into the locations and behavior of devices.
Hybrid deployments blend private RAN infrastructure with MNO‑hosted core services. Ports, airports, and large industrial campuses often adopt this approach, which provides dedicated coverage and local control while relying on the MNO for core network services and lawful interception compliance. Geofencing and Quiet Zones for High-Security Facilities
To enforce strict mobile‑device policies in sensitive environments, SS8 offers the Quiet Zone solution, which draws on its geofencing, passive location, active location, and heuristic analysis technologies. Monitoring and control capabilities within established Quiet Zones make it possible to identify and disable voice and data services for unauthorized mobile devices, including phones and anything else equipped with a SIM. This capability is often used to identify contraband cell phones in prisons, alongside applications from detecting a bomb detonation device to an illicit camera exfiltrating information from a secure facility.
The SS8 platform’s passive location technology defines a geofence perimeter around the Quiet Zone and identifies devices on the cellular network as they enter or exit. Enforcement practices include maintaining an Allow list that grants service to known, authorized devices such as handsets owned by trusted personnel. Visitors, vendors, and nearby residents can be temporarily added to the Allow List based on network policy. Disallowed devices can be added to a Deny List, with full auditability and regulatory confirmation workflows.
When detected, potentially unauthorized devices can be shifted to active location monitoring, with heuristics such as pattern-of-life analysis to detect their movements, dwell time, and behavior within the geofence. When the system determines with high confidence that a candidate device for enforcement is physically inside the restricted area, it can be manually or automatically disabled on the network.
